Party Ham Sandwiches
Party Ham Sandwiches are a crowd-pleasing, savory treat featuring tender ham and melted mozzarella cheese nestled in soft rolls, all coated with a flavorful buttery mixture. Perfect for gatherings or game days, they combine warm, cheesy goodness with a hint of mustard and onion for a delicious, easy-to-make sandwich delight.
Ingredients
Instructions
- Cut the rolls lengthwise with an electric knife. (If electric knife is not available, freeze rolls for 2 to 3 hours to make cutting easier.)
- Mix the margarine, sugar, mustard, minced onion flakes, poppy seed, and garlic powder. Heat in the microwave for 2 to 3 minutes and stir well.
- Pour half of the hot mixture over the bottom half of the rolls.
- Add the ham and mozzarella cheese slices on top of the bottom half of the rolls.
- Place the top half of the rolls over the ham and cheese.
- Pour the remaining hot mixture over the top of the assembled sandwiches.
- Bake at 350°F for 20 minutes.
Tips & Substitutions
For a twist, consider using different cheeses like sharp cheddar or pepper jack instead of mozzarella. You can also substitute the ham with turkey or roast beef for a varied flavor. If you're short on time, pre-made sandwich spreads can replace the margarine mixture. For easier slicing, use an electric knife or freeze the rolls for 2-3 hours before cutting.

Storage & Reheating
Leftover sandwiches can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, wrap them in aluminum foil and bake at 350°F for about 10-15 minutes until heated through. Alternatively, you can microwave individual sandwiches for about 30-40 seconds, but the oven method will keep them crispier.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I make these sandwiches 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are the sandwiches a few hours in advance. Assemble them and keep them covered in the refrigerator, then bake just before serving. This allows the flavors to meld while ensuring they are fresh and warm for your guests.
What can I use instead of margarine?
If you prefer not to use margarine, you can substitute with unsalted butter or olive oil for a healthier option. Both will provide a rich flavor to the sandwich mixture and enhance the overall taste.
Can I freeze these sandwiches?
Yes, you can freeze the assembled sandwiches before baking. Wrap them tightly in plastic wrap and foil, then store in the freezer for up to 3 months. When ready to bake, thaw them in the refrigerator overnight and bake as directed.
